For the 2026 school year, there are 4 public charter schools serving 1,352 students in Academie Lafayette School District. This district's average charter testing ranking is 10/10, which is in the top 5% of public charter schools in Missouri.
Public Charter Schools in Academie Lafayette School District have an average math proficiency score of 55% (versus the Missouri public charter school average of 25%), and reading proficiency score of 64% (versus the 28%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 43%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Missouri public charter school average of 86% (majority Black).

The revenue/student of $10,325 in this school district is less than the state median of $15,081. The school district revenue/student has declined by 14%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$9,419 is less than the state median of $13,908. The school district spending/student has declined by 16% over four school years.
